Bap Population - Udhampur, Jammu and Kashmir

Bap is a medium size village located in Chenani Tehsil of Udhampur district, Jammu and Kashmir with total 342 families residing. The Bap village has population of 1901 of which 965 are males while 936 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bap village population of children with age 0-6 is 362 which makes up 19.04 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bap village is 970 which is higher than Jammu and Kashmir state average of 889. Child Sex Ratio for the Bap as per census is 1045, higher than Jammu and Kashmir average of 862.

Bap village has lower literacy rate compared to Jammu and Kashmir. In 2011, literacy rate of Bap village was 52.37 % compared to 67.16 % of Jammu and Kashmir. In Bap Male literacy stands at 65.86 % while female literacy rate was 38.22 %.

Caste Factor

In Bap village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C) &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 36.40 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 25.41 % of total population in Bap village.

Work Profile

In Bap village out of total population, 1017 were engaged in work activities. 50.44 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 49.56 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1017 workers engaged in Main Work, 415 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 2 were Agricultural labourer.
